(a)find the potential drops across the two resistors shown in figure. (b) A voltmeter of resistance `(600 Omega)`is used to measure the potential drop across the `(300 Omega)` resistor.What will be the measured potential drop?

(a)the current in the circuit is `(100V)/(300 Omega+200 Omega)=0.2A.`
The potential dorp across the `(300 Omega)` resistor is
`(300 Omega)xx0.2A=60 V.`
Similarly, the drop scross the `(200 Omega)` resistor is 40 V.
(b) The equivalent resistance, when the voltmeter is connected across `(300 Omega)`,is
`R=(200 Omega)+(600 Omegaxx300 Omega)/(600 Omega+300 Omega)=(400 Omega).`
Thus, the main current from the battery is
`i=(100 V)/(400 Omega)=0.25 A.`
The potential drop across the `(200 Omega)` resistor is, therefore, `(200 Omegaxx0.25A=50 V)`and that across `(300 Omega)`is also 50 V. this is also the potential drop across the voltmeter is 50V.
